My artistic work is a "memory picture
of a shopping cart". Blindfolded, I drew the shopping cart blindfolded on a body sized paper, trying to memorize its composition: what is the shape of the basket, the grid in between, the connection to the handle, where is
the coin deposit? - where is the coin
deposit key, how does the construction lead to the rolling wheels. From a multiplicity of these "blind investigations“-drawings I then decided on the version submitted here, which contains these "core elements" of a shopping cart. However without being immediately recognizable as such, but could be guessed at longer observation. The COURTYARD DRAWING I would like to propose the characteristics of such a drawing as a spatial experience for the BVL courtyard. The drawing will be shown in enlarged dimension (about 115 sqm area) transferred to the flooring (embedded in the flooring with environmentally friendly asphalt paint). For users and visitors of the BVL, depending on the location and perspective, there will always be a different image of one and the same drawing and will only become recognizable as a shopping cart in the course of a certain attention reveal itself as a shopping cart. But it is also a freely readable spatial drawing, which rhythmically deconstructs the inner courtyard by means of lines and thereby created surface determinations, rhythmically declines and so also allow other associations.
